Understanding High Pressure Power Steering Hoses


High-pressure power steering hoses are critical components in modern hydraulic power steering systems, designed to facilitate smooth and efficient steering control in vehicles. These hoses transport hydraulic fluid from the power steering pump to the steering gear, allowing for the necessary assistance to steer the vehicle, especially at low speeds. Understanding their function, construction, and maintenance is essential for ensuring optimal performance and longevity of a vehicle's steering system.


Function of High-Pressure Power Steering Hoses


The primary function of high-pressure power steering hoses is to carry pressurized hydraulic fluid from the pump to the steering gear. When the driver turns the steering wheel, the steering column transmits this movement to the power steering pump, which then generates hydraulic pressure. This pressure is directed through the high-pressure hose, allowing the steering mechanism to reduce the amount of effort needed to turn the wheel. This system enhances driver comfort and control, especially in larger vehicles where steering effort can be substantial.


Construction and Materials


High-pressure power steering hoses are specifically engineered to withstand the extreme pressures generated within the steering system, which can be as high as 1,500 to 2,000 psi. These hoses are typically constructed from high-quality materials such as rubber or thermoplastic, reinforced with braided steel or textile layers to prevent bursting and ensure durability. The internal surface of these hoses is designed to resist the corrosive effects of hydraulic fluid, minimizing wear and preventing leaks.

Manufacturers also design these hoses to be flexible enough to handle the movements of the engine and suspension while maintaining structural integrity under pressure. The fittings at either end of the hose are usually crimped or swaged to create a secure and leak-proof connection to the power steering pump and the steering gear.


Maintenance and Common Issues


Regular maintenance of high-pressure power steering hoses is crucial for vehicle safety and performance. Over time, hoses can experience wear and tear due to heat, exposure to the elements, and constant movement. Common issues include leaks, which can lead to decreased power steering performance and potentially cause complete system failure if not addressed promptly.


Drivers should watch for signs of wear, such as cracks, bulges, or any fluid leaks around the hose connections. It is advisable to inspect the power steering system regularly, especially during routine vehicle maintenance. If any damage is detected, replacing the hose promptly will prevent further complications and ensure safe vehicle operation.
